Friday’s prep basketball stars

The standout performers from Wednesday night’s high school basketball action:

BOYS

Josh Bevan, Marysville Pilchuck. The senior continued his hot streak with 29 points in the Tomahawks’ 71-49 victory over Oak Harbor.

Willy Enick, Tulalip Heritage. Enick scored a game-high 34 points in the Hawks’ 76-55 victory over Shoreline Christian.

Colby Kyle, Monroe. Kyle posted a double-double with 16 points and 12 rebounds in a 69-58 loss to Mount Vernon.

GIRLS

Jordyn Edwards and Mikayla Pivec, Lynnwood. The two Royals seniors combined to score 36 points (19 for Pivec and 17 for Edwards) as Lynnwood defeated Glacier Peak 79-49 to clinch its sixth consecutive league title.

Madison Pollock, Snohomish. Pollock head a team-high 19 points to lead the Panthers to a 50-48 victory over Monroe and keep Snohomish undefeated in Wesco 4A play.

Chloe Brown, Highland Christian. Brown scored 28 points in a season-ending loss to Lummi.
